OverviewGet licensed faster and close deals sooner with Arizona-specific law, contracts, and client-ready systems. Prepare for the Arizona real estate exam and step into your first transactions with confidence using a practical, Arizona-first playbook. You'll learn the rules that show up in real deals-agency and fiduciary duty, disclosure landmines (water rights, HOA, septic, and more), fair housing risks, and the purchase contract habits that prevent deadline disasters. Then you shift from test prep to field execution: contract review shortcuts, exam-day routines, brokerage-selection red flags, lead generation that feels human, and a deal-closing mindset built for Phoenix, Scottsdale, Tucson, and beyond. What to expect inside: - Arizona licensing blueprint: what the state cares about, how to study smarter, and what the exam never says out loud. - State law made practical: agency relationships, fiduciary duty, and compliance without law-degree language. - Disclosure essentials: water rights, HOA restrictions, septic considerations, and the small details that derail deals. - Contracts without fear: purchase agreements explained clearly, addenda that must be documented, and how as-is can backfire. - Fast contract QA: a quick review method to catch missing initials, deadlines, and deal-breaking omissions. - Money and math clarity: commissions, net sheets, loan basics (conventional/VA/FHA), and common calculation traps. - Study systems that work when youre tired: retention tricks, peak-focus timing, and exam-day rituals. - Brokerage selection: commission-split reality checks, mentorship vs management, and contract red flags. - Lead generation without desperation: scripts that convert, open house habits, referral loops, and local social strategy. - Deal-closing mindset: confidence under pressure, negotiation cadence, and rules that keep transactions alive.
